Impala Motors Location

3316 Thomas Street, Memphis, TN - 38127

Phone : 901-358-9300

Here is detailed route to Impala Motors, Memphis Used cars dealership. Make sure you call on 901-358-9300 before you arrive at their location which is 3316 Thomas Street, Memphis, TN. Their official timings are 8:00 AM to 7:00 PM Monday to Saturday. Make sure you call and get appointment before hand.
you can always call or text them on 901-358-9300 to get the Directions to their store

Impala Motors, 3316 Thomas Street's Map in memphis


Other Nearby Dealer Locations
Jim Doran Chevrolet Directions
McMinnville, OR
D F W Automax Directions
Rockwall, TX
KC Motor Sports Directions
PLAINFIELD, IL
Wessels Used Cars Directions
Dillsburg, PA
Motion Auto Sales Directions
DALLAS, TX